Answer:
Pyramid B is 2.6888 times the volume of pyramid A
Step-by-step explanation:
The volume is proportional to the height, and to the square of the linear measure of the base.
Then the ratio of volumes will be ...
B/A = (592²·247)/(492²·133) = 86564608/32194512 ≈ 2.6888
Pyramid B has the greater volume by a factor of about 2.6888.
_____
<em>Additional comment</em>
The actual volumes in cubic meters will be 1/48 of the numbers we used in the ratio above.
If you recall that the side length is related to the perimeter by ...
P = 4s ⇒ s = P/4
and the volume is ...
V = 1/3s²h
Then you have ...
V = 1/3(P/4)²h = 1/48·P²h . . . . . . P²h is the number we used above
